Noch ist die aktuelle Ubuntu-Version keinen Monat alt, da veröffentlicht Mark Shuttleworth in seinem Blog bereits Pläne für die kommenden Versionen.
GCC
Um Unix-Software von Solaris nach Linux zu portieren, sollte im Grunde das Neukompilieren reichen. Manchmal ist es damit auch tatsächlich getan. In vielen anderen Fällen aber lauern Fallen. Wie man sie erkennt und umgeht, beschreibt dieser Beitrag.
Beim Cross-Kompilieren für ein Embedded-System übersetzen Sie Ihren Quellcode für eine andere CPU als die im PC des Entwicklers eingebaute. Der folgende Workshop erklärt zwei Wege, wie das mit dem GCC als Crosscompiler zu bewerkstelligen ist.
Einem Prozess bei der Arbeit auf die Finger sehen - unter Linux erlaubt das Ptrace. Das eingebaute Tool nutzen hilfreiche Debugger wie feindselige Prozess-Kidnapper gleichermaßen. Ein CPAN-Modul führt die Technik in Perl ein, und wo das nicht reicht, helfen in C geschriebene Erweiterungen weiter.
Der Lisp-Freak Paul Graham hat die erste Version seiner Sprache Arc veröffentlicht. Graham lobt vor allem die Kürze von Arc-Quelltext und hat einen Programmiersprachen-Wettbewerb gestartet.
Die BSD-Variante FreeBSD aktualisiert mit dem Release der Version 7.0 die Produktpalette. Vor allem die Performance und die Ausnutzung von Multi-Prozessor-Architekturen soll sich laut Ankündigung auf der Webseite des Projekts dramatisch verbessert haben.
Dass es die Fragen des Winterrätsels in Ausgabe 01/2008 in sich haben, war der Redaktion des Linux-Magazins klar. Dass keine der zahlreichen Einsendungen auf LINUXWORLDDOMINATIONFAST kommen würde, überraschte dann doch. Der kenntnisreichste Leser scheiterte an Klaus Knoppers Herkunftsland:...
Ob Accesspoints, Firewalls, Network Attached Storage, Navigationsgeräte oder Handys - auf unendlich vielen Geräten läuft Linux. Über das Warum, das Wie und über die Eigenschaften typischer Embedded-Architekturen klärt dieser Artikel auf.
Eine einfache Schaltung hat das Zeug, eine ganze Handvoll proprietärer Adapter zu ersetzen, die sonst den Tisch des Embedded-Entwicklers vollmüllen. Mit anderer Firmware mutiert USBprog auch zur USB-to-RS232-Schnittstelle oder steuert Lampen und Motoren.
Die Entwickler der GNU Compiler Collection (GCC) haben mit Version 4.2.3 eine Ausgabe veröffentlicht, die mehrere Fehler behebt.
Virtualbox bietet gleich drei verschiedene Arten, eine virtuelle Maschine ans Netzwerk zu koppeln. Wer volle Kontrolle möchte, muss aber auf die Kommandozeile abtauchen und kryptische Befehle eingeben.
Die einen lieben, die anderen hassen sie: die flexible, aber komplexe C++-Standardbibliothek STL. Entwickler des zweiten Lagers können ihren Quellcode nun fast umsonst parallelisieren. Den Werkzeugkasten dazu liefert OMPTL - vorausgesetzt der Compiler beherrscht den OpenMP-Standard.
Asus stellt einen mobilen Linux-Rechner vor, der mit den Attributen klein, leicht, günstig das Zeug zum in jeder Hinsicht tragbaren Begleiter hat. Das Linux-Magazin hat den Kleinen getestet.
Ubuntu hat einen schlanken Ableger für den Produktiveinsatz auf Servern. Der verwirrt nicht mit grafischem Schnickschnack, sondern erinnert sich der Unix-Tugenden Purismus und Transparenz. Vor Kurzem hat eine neue Version das Licht der Welt erblickt - die beiliegende CD enthält sie.










